Hi,
I've just switched to "New EE", Full Fibre 500 Essentials. I have three Wifi Extenders.
Since moving from Sky broadband, when everything was working perfectly, I cannot connect my 4 smart plugs, a wifi lightswitch or an underfloor heating thermostat.
I've gone into my Hub settings, and turned off 5 Ghz. But I still can't connect.
It's driving me insane, my outdoor office heating is managed on these smart devices and I'm freezing!
I've called EE, they won't help as I'm asking about third party devices.

For the WiFI security method, do you have the option to change it to WPA or WPA 2? I've a feeling this will be a result of your devices needing legacy WiFi settings within the smart hub and @XRaySpeX has knowledge of this.

Some devices remember the network settings and don't allow you to connect to the new network unless you fully reset them. I had that issue with wifi camera. I had to factory reset it and set it up as a new device.

I have managed to connect by a different method. I reset the plugs by holding the power button and instead of using the app to connect directly, I connected to the smart plugs wifi network from my phone.
I still can't connect to one last smart device, which is a SONOFF light switch. I've tried everything. Might replace the light switch.

Rather than change the security, some smart devices are 2.4Ghz only. So if you log into the router go to the advanced wireless settings and switch off the 5Ghz band off whilst you connect the device.
You may also need to change the Mode type for really stubborn devices.
Once connected, switch back the 5Ghz band and you should be OK.
